public class CallPriorityComparer : IComparer<MethodInfo>
{
public int Compare( MethodInfo x, MethodInfo y )
{
if ( x == null && y == null )
return 0;
if ( x == null )
return 1;
if ( y == null )
return -1;
var xPriority = GetPriority( x );
var yPriority = GetPriority( y );
if ( xPriority > yPriority )
return 1;
if ( xPriority < yPriority )
return -1;
return 0;
}
private int GetPriority( MethodInfo mi )
{
object[] objs = mi.GetCustomAttributes( typeof( CallPriorityAttribute ), true );
if ( objs.Length == 0 )
return 0;
if ( !(objs[0] is CallPriorityAttribute attr) )
return 0;
return attr.Priority;
}
}
